The graduate certificate in waste management for the food industry is essential to address the growing need for sustainable practices in food production and processing. With increasing regulatory pressures and consumer demand for eco-friendly solutions, professionals equipped with specialized knowledge in waste reduction, recycling, and resource optimization are in high demand. This course bridges the gap between industry requirements and sustainable innovation, ensuring businesses minimize environmental impact while maximizing efficiency.

According to recent data, the UK food industry generates over 10 million tonnes of waste annually, costing businesses approximately £3 billion. By 2030, the UK aims to reduce food waste by 50%, creating a surge in demand for skilled waste management professionals. Below are key statistics highlighting the industry demand:

Career Roles and Key Responsibilities for Graduate Certificate in Waste Management for Food Industry

Career Role Key Responsibilities
Waste Management Specialist Develop and implement waste reduction strategies
Monitor waste disposal processes
Ensure compliance with environmental regulations
Sustainability Coordinator Promote sustainable practices within the organization
Conduct sustainability audits
Educate staff on waste management protocols
Environmental Compliance Officer Ensure adherence to environmental laws
Conduct regular inspections
Prepare compliance reports
Food Waste Auditor Analyze food waste data
Identify areas for improvement
Recommend waste reduction solutions
Recycling Program Manager Oversee recycling initiatives
Coordinate with waste disposal companies
Track recycling metrics
Waste Reduction Consultant Provide expert advice on waste minimization
Develop waste management plans
Conduct training sessions
Operations Manager (Waste Management) Supervise waste management operations
Optimize waste processing systems
Ensure cost-effective waste solutions
